site stats

Software object oriented

WebThis set of Software Engineering Multiple Choice Questions & Answers (MCQs) focuses on “Object Oriented Software Design – 1”. 1. Choose the incorrect statement in terms of Objects. a) Objects are abstractions of real-world. b) Objects can’t manage themselves. c) Objects encapsulate state and representation information. WebFeb 3, 2024 · Object-oriented programming is a popular programming style in many languages. By defining sets of classes that represent and encapsulate objects in a …

What

WebDecember 25th, 2024 - Object Oriented Software in Ada 95 2nd Edition Michael A Smith The book is aimed at intermediate level undergraduates that is those who have studied the … WebJan 5, 2024 · Although there are 23 design patterns listed in Design Patterns: Elements of Reusable Object-Oriented Software, of those there are 7 that are considered the most influential or important. This section outlines the 7 best software design patterns, why they are important, and when to use them. 1. Singleton Design Pattern how to rid ringworm https://patriaselectric.com

SOLID: The First 5 Principles of Object Oriented Design

WebDec 15, 2024 · Object-oriented design (OOD) is the process of creating a software system or application utilising an object-oriented paradigm. This technique permits the creation of a … Object-oriented design (OOD) is the process of planning a system of interacting objects for the purpose of solving a software problem. It is one approach to software design. Webocw.mit.edu northern black hills rv

Software design pattern - Wikipedia

Category:What is object-oriented in software engineering?

Tags:Software object oriented

Software object oriented

Top Applications of OOPs (Object Oriented Programing)

WebYet, many proponents of object-oriented programming are programmers, including computer science professors, who have hailed it for its technical advantages over … WebAug 2, 2013 · Differences that I can think of are that you can have more than one objects on a class, where as in modular programming you are supposed to have only 1 module (1 …

Software object oriented

Did you know?

WebJan 5, 2024 · Although there are 23 design patterns listed in Design Patterns: Elements of Reusable Object-Oriented Software, of those there are 7 that are considered the most … WebSOLID is an acronym for five object oriented design principles that make software understandable, flexible, and maintainable. SOLID stands for: • Single Responsibility: A class should have a single responsibility. • Open/Closed: Software should be open for extension and closed for modification.

WebApr 30, 2024 · Object-oriented refers to a programming language, system or software methodology that is built on the concepts of logical objects. It works through the creation, … WebWith SIMOTION, you can carry out object-oriented programming in accordance with IEC 61131-3 ED3. Complex applications can be set up in a clear object structure that precisely …

WebKarena selain banyak digunakan oleh programmer lain, konsep OOP ini membuat kode program yang dibuat menjadi lebih terstruktur, efisien, dan efektif. Secara definisi, OOP adalah singkatan dari Object Oriented Programming, yakni suatu metode pemrograman yang orientasinya terletak pada objek. Buat kamu yang menekuni skill pemrograman pasti … WebSep 21, 2024 · SOLID is an acronym for the first five object-oriented design (OOD) principles by Robert C. Martin (also known as Uncle Bob ). Note: While these principles can apply to …

WebDecember 25th, 2024 - Object Oriented Software in Ada 95 2nd Edition Michael A Smith The book is aimed at intermediate level undergraduates that is those who have studied the basics of program design and are acquainted with the fundamental concepts of data types and program control structures

WebGrady Booch's “Booch” method, Ivar Jacobson's Object-Oriented Software Engineering method and James Rumbaugh's Object Modeling Technique were unified, resulting in the … northern black hills trail systemWebObject-oriented programming has several advantages over procedural programming: OOP is faster and easier to execute. OOP provides a clear structure for the programs. OOP helps … northern black hills real estate listingsWebObject-Oriented Design is a design approach that emphasizes the use of reusable objects to create modular, well-tested software. This improves both the maintainability and extensibility of code, as well as its readability by other developers. Additionally, it allows for more efficient communication between different parts of a program, leading ... how to rid pinwormsWeb2 days ago · 8 Tips For Object-Oriented Programming in Python. Object oriented programming language is a programming paradigm which is widely used in software design as it makes the code reusable and reduces code redundancy. It uses classes and objects to implement real world objects in programming. Python and other languages like C++, … northern black dragon martial artsWebApr 15, 2024 · Object-oriented programming (OOP) is a fundamental programming paradigm used by nearly every developer at some point in their career. OOP is the most popular programming paradigm used for software development and is taught as the … northern black hills wyomingWebMar 26, 2024 · Object-oriented programming (OOP) is a computer programming model that organizes software design around data, or objects, rather than functions and logic. OOP … northern blacking ltdWebOct 31, 1994 · Capturing a wealth of experience about the design of object-oriented software, four top-notch designers present a catalog of simple and succinct solutions to commonly occurring design problems. Previously … northern black polished ware - gupta age